
人工智能和数据挖掘是现代技术领域中两个极其重要的概念,虽然它们在功能和应用上有所不同,但在数据处理和分析方面有着紧密的联系。人工智能指的是通过模拟人类智能的方式来执行任务的技术,包括机器学习、自然语言处理等;而数据挖掘则是从大量数据中提取有价值信息和模式的过程。其中,人工智能可以利用数据挖掘的结果来改进其算法和模型,使其变得更加智能和高效。举例来说,人工智能系统可以通过数据挖掘技术从历史数据中识别出某种特定的用户行为模式,从而在未来的用户交互中提供更为个性化的推荐和服务。
一、人工智能的定义与基本概念
人工智能(AI)是指计算机系统能够执行通常需要人类智能才能完成的任务。这些任务包括但不限于视觉感知、语音识别、决策和语言翻译。AI的核心在于其算法和模型,这些算法和模型通过学习和自我改进来提高其性能。机器学习是AI的一个重要分支,通过输入大量数据来训练模型,使其能够进行预测或分类。深度学习是机器学习的一个子领域,它利用多层神经网络来处理复杂的数据和任务。自然语言处理(NLP)则是另一个重要领域,旨在使计算机能够理解和生成人类语言。AI系统通常依赖于大量的高质量数据来训练其模型,这使得数据挖掘成为一个关键步骤。
二、数据挖掘的定义与基本概念
数据挖掘是从大量的数据集中提取有价值信息和模式的过程。它涉及多个步骤,包括数据预处理、数据变换、数据建模和结果评估。数据挖掘技术可以用于各种应用场景,如市场分析、欺诈检测、医疗诊断和个性化推荐。数据预处理是数据挖掘的第一步,主要目的是清洗和整理数据,包括处理缺失值、去除噪声和标准化数据。数据变换则是将原始数据转化为适合建模的数据形式。数据建模是数据挖掘的核心步骤,通过选择和应用适当的算法来识别数据中的模式和关系。最后,结果评估是对模型的性能进行评估和验证,以确保其准确性和可靠性。
三、人工智能与数据挖掘的关系
人工智能和数据挖掘在数据处理和分析方面有着紧密的联系。人工智能系统可以利用数据挖掘的结果来改进其算法和模型,从而提高其智能化和自动化水平。数据挖掘提供了大量的有价值数据,这些数据可以作为AI模型的训练数据,帮助AI系统识别模式和关系,进行预测和决策。例如,在电子商务领域,数据挖掘可以识别用户的购买行为模式,这些模式可以用于训练AI系统,使其能够提供更加个性化的产品推荐。此外,AI技术也可以反过来帮助数据挖掘过程变得更加高效和准确。例如,深度学习算法可以用于处理和分析大规模数据集,从中提取出更为复杂和有价值的模式。
四、人工智能的实际应用
人工智能在各个领域都有广泛的应用。在医疗领域,AI可以用于医学影像分析、疾病预测和个性化治疗方案。例如,AI系统可以通过分析大量的医学影像数据,识别出早期的癌症病变,从而提高诊断的准确性。在金融领域,AI可以用于风险管理、欺诈检测和自动化交易。通过分析历史交易数据和市场趋势,AI系统可以预测市场走势,帮助投资者做出更为明智的决策。在制造业,AI可以用于生产过程的优化和设备维护。通过分析生产数据和设备状态,AI系统可以提前预测设备故障,减少停机时间,提高生产效率。在自动驾驶领域,AI技术使得车辆能够感知周围环境,自主进行驾驶决策,从而提高道路安全性和交通效率。
五、数据挖掘的实际应用
数据挖掘在各种行业中都有广泛的应用。在市场营销领域,数据挖掘可以用于客户细分、市场分析和广告效果评估。例如,通过分析客户的购买行为和社交媒体数据,企业可以识别出不同的客户群体,制定针对性的营销策略。在金融领域,数据挖掘可以用于信用评分、投资组合优化和风险管理。通过分析客户的信用历史和金融行为,银行可以评估贷款申请人的信用风险,制定合理的贷款政策。在医疗领域,数据挖掘可以用于疾病预测、药物研发和个性化医疗。通过分析患者的病历数据和基因数据,医生可以预测疾病的发生风险,制定个性化的治疗方案。在零售业,数据挖掘可以用于库存管理、销售预测和客户推荐。通过分析历史销售数据和市场趋势,零售商可以优化库存配置,提高销售效率。
六、人工智能和数据挖掘的挑战和未来发展
尽管人工智能和数据挖掘技术已经取得了显著的进展,但在实际应用中仍然面临许多挑战。数据质量和隐私保护是两个重要的问题。在数据挖掘过程中,数据质量的高低直接影响到结果的准确性和可靠性。数据缺失、噪声和不一致性都是常见的问题。此外,随着大数据时代的到来,数据隐私保护变得越来越重要。在AI系统的训练过程中,如何保护用户的隐私数据是一个亟待解决的问题。未来,随着技术的不断发展,人工智能和数据挖掘将会更加紧密地结合在一起,提供更加智能化和个性化的服务。例如,随着深度学习算法的不断改进,AI系统将能够处理和分析更加复杂和海量的数据,从中提取出更加有价值的信息和模式。在数据隐私保护方面,联邦学习和差分隐私等新技术的应用将有助于解决数据隐私保护问题。
七、如何学习人工智能和数据挖掘
学习人工智能和数据挖掘需要掌握多方面的知识和技能。数学和统计学是基础,编程技能和算法理解是关键。在数学和统计学方面,需要掌握线性代数、微积分和概率论等基础知识。在编程方面,Python是最为常用的编程语言,熟练掌握Python编程是学习AI和数据挖掘的基本要求。此外,还需要掌握一些常用的AI和数据挖掘库和框架,如TensorFlow、PyTorch、scikit-learn和pandas等。数据挖掘方面,需要了解数据预处理、特征选择、模型训练和评估等基本步骤和方法。通过参加相关的在线课程和实战项目,可以进一步提高自己的技能和经验。阅读相关的学术论文和技术博客,了解最新的发展动态和应用案例,也是学习AI和数据挖掘的重要途径。
八、人工智能和数据挖掘的伦理与法律问题
随着人工智能和数据挖掘技术的广泛应用,伦理和法律问题也越来越受到关注。数据隐私保护和算法公平性是两个重要的伦理问题。在数据隐私方面,如何在数据挖掘过程中保护用户的隐私数据,防止数据泄露和滥用,是一个亟待解决的问题。在算法公平性方面,如何避免AI系统在决策过程中产生偏见和歧视,也是一个重要的伦理问题。例如,在招聘和贷款审批等领域,AI系统如果使用了有偏见的数据进行训练,可能会导致决策结果的不公平。在法律方面,各国政府和组织正在制定相关的法律法规,以规范AI和数据挖掘技术的应用和发展。例如,欧盟的《通用数据保护条例》(GDPR)对数据隐私保护提出了严格的要求,美国的《算法问责法》则要求对AI系统的决策过程进行透明和问责。未来,随着技术的不断发展和应用,伦理和法律问题将会变得更加复杂和重要。
九、人工智能和数据挖掘的趋势与前景
人工智能和数据挖掘技术正在迅速发展,并在各个领域展现出广阔的应用前景。深度学习、联邦学习和边缘计算是未来的重要趋势。深度学习作为AI技术的前沿,正在不断突破其在语音识别、图像处理和自然语言理解等方面的能力。联邦学习是一种新的机器学习框架,它允许多个组织在不共享数据的情况下协同训练AI模型,从而保护数据隐私。边缘计算则是将计算资源部署在网络的边缘,以减少数据传输的延迟和成本,提高实时数据处理的能力。未来,随着5G技术的普及,边缘计算将会在物联网、智能城市和自动驾驶等领域发挥重要作用。数据挖掘技术也将继续发展,特别是在大数据和云计算的支持下,数据挖掘将能够处理和分析更加海量和复杂的数据,从中提取出更加有价值的信息和模式。人工智能和数据挖掘技术的结合,将会推动各个行业的智能化转型,带来更加高效和个性化的服务。
十、人工智能和数据挖掘的实际案例分析
为了更好地理解人工智能和数据挖掘的应用,我们来看一些实际的案例分析。在零售业,亚马逊通过AI和数据挖掘技术实现了个性化推荐和库存管理。亚马逊利用数据挖掘技术分析客户的购买历史和浏览行为,识别出不同的客户偏好,从而提供个性化的产品推荐。这不仅提高了客户的购物体验,也增加了销售额。亚马逊还利用AI技术进行库存管理,通过预测产品的需求量,优化库存配置,减少库存成本。在医疗领域,IBM的Watson健康平台利用AI和数据挖掘技术实现了医学影像分析和疾病预测。Watson通过分析大量的医学影像数据,识别出早期的病变,提高了诊断的准确性。在金融领域,摩根大通利用AI和数据挖掘技术实现了自动化交易和风险管理。通过分析市场数据和历史交易数据,AI系统能够预测市场走势,自动执行交易策略,提高了交易效率和收益。这些实际案例展示了人工智能和数据挖掘在各个领域的广泛应用和巨大潜力。
总的来说,人工智能和数据挖掘是现代技术领域中不可或缺的重要组成部分。它们通过紧密结合,为各行各业提供了智能化和自动化的解决方案,推动了社会和经济的发展。学习和掌握这些技术,将为个人和组织带来巨大的机遇和竞争优势。
相关问答FAQs:
人工智能和数据挖掘是什么?
人工智能(AI)和数据挖掘(Data Mining)是当今技术领域中两个重要的概念,它们在各个行业中的应用正在迅速增长。尽管这两个概念有时会被混淆,但它们实际上是不同的领域,各自具有独特的特点和应用。
人工智能是计算机科学的一个分支,旨在创造可以模拟人类智能的机器和系统。AI的目标是使计算机能够执行通常需要人类智慧的任务,例如视觉识别、自然语言处理、决策制定和自动化等。人工智能的实现通常依赖于算法和模型,尤其是在深度学习和机器学习等子领域的发展。随着技术的进步,AI的应用范围已扩展到医疗、金融、交通、制造和娱乐等多个领域。
在医疗领域,人工智能可以通过分析患者数据来辅助诊断,提高疾病预测的准确性。在金融领域,AI能够实时分析市场趋势,为投资者提供决策支持。此外,人工智能还在智能家居、虚拟助手和自动驾驶等领域展示了其强大的潜力。
数据挖掘则是从大量数据中提取有用信息和知识的过程。它涉及使用统计学、机器学习和数据库技术来发现数据中的模式和趋势。数据挖掘的目标是将原始数据转化为可操作的信息,以帮助企业和组织做出更明智的决策。
数据挖掘的过程包括数据预处理、数据分析和结果解释等步骤。通过这些步骤,组织可以识别客户行为、市场趋势和潜在的业务机会。例如,零售商可以通过数据挖掘分析客户购买模式,从而优化库存管理和营销策略。在金融领域,数据挖掘可以帮助机构检测异常交易,降低欺诈风险。
尽管人工智能和数据挖掘有各自的定义和功能,但它们之间存在紧密的联系。人工智能可以增强数据挖掘的能力,通过机器学习算法对数据进行更深层次的分析和理解。同时,数据挖掘也为人工智能提供了丰富的数据基础,帮助AI模型进行训练和优化。
人工智能和数据挖掘的主要应用场景是什么?
人工智能和数据挖掘的应用场景非常广泛,涵盖了多个行业和领域。具体来说,以下是一些主要的应用场景:
在医疗保健领域,人工智能被用于辅助医生进行诊断和治疗决策。通过分析患者的历史数据和医学文献,AI可以帮助识别潜在的健康风险,并提供个性化的治疗方案。同时,数据挖掘技术可以用于分析患者的医疗记录,识别疾病模式,从而提高疾病预防和管理的效果。
金融服务行业同样受益于人工智能和数据挖掘的结合。AI可以实时分析市场数据和交易行为,帮助投资者做出更明智的投资决策。此外,数据挖掘可以识别客户的消费行为和信用风险,帮助金融机构降低欺诈风险和提高客户满意度。
在零售行业,商家利用数据挖掘技术分析客户的购物行为,从而优化产品推荐和库存管理。人工智能的应用使得个性化营销成为可能,商家可以根据客户的购买历史和偏好,推送相关的产品和促销信息,提高销售转化率。
制造业也在逐步采用人工智能和数据挖掘来优化生产流程。通过分析生产数据,企业可以识别瓶颈和效率低下的环节,从而进行改进。此外,AI可以用于预测设备故障,降低维护成本和停机时间。
在交通运输领域,人工智能被广泛应用于自动驾驶技术和智能交通管理。通过对交通数据的挖掘和分析,AI可以优化交通流量,减少拥堵,提高运输效率。
社交媒体和在线平台也利用人工智能和数据挖掘来分析用户行为,改进用户体验。通过分析用户的互动数据,平台可以更好地理解用户需求,提供个性化的内容推荐和广告投放。
总的来说,人工智能和数据挖掘的结合正在改变各个行业的运作模式,提高效率、降低成本,并推动创新。
人工智能和数据挖掘的未来发展趋势如何?
随着技术的不断进步,人工智能和数据挖掘的未来发展趋势将会更加显著,主要体现在以下几个方面:
首先,人工智能的算法和模型将会更加复杂和高效。随着深度学习和强化学习等技术的不断成熟,AI将能够处理更加复杂的数据集,并实现更高的准确性和效率。这将使得人工智能在更多领域的应用成为可能,例如在自然语言处理和计算机视觉等领域的突破。
其次,数据挖掘技术将更加智能化。随着大数据时代的到来,数据的量和种类不断增加,传统的数据挖掘方法面临着巨大的挑战。未来,自动化的数据挖掘工具将会成为主流,能够自动识别数据中的模式和趋势,降低人工干预的需求。
此外,人工智能和数据挖掘的结合将推动“智能决策”的发展。企业将能够基于AI和数据挖掘的分析结果,做出更加迅速和准确的决策。这种智能决策不仅限于商业领域,还可以应用于公共服务、城市管理等方面,提高社会整体的运行效率。
在数据隐私和伦理方面,随着AI和数据挖掘技术的广泛应用,相关的法律法规和伦理标准也将逐步建立。如何保护用户的隐私,确保数据的安全,将是未来发展的重要议题。
最后,人工智能和数据挖掘的普及将推动跨行业的融合与创新。不同领域的企业将通过AI和数据挖掘技术进行合作,推动新产品和服务的开发。例如,医疗与科技的结合将促进个性化医疗的发展,金融与人工智能的结合将推动智能投顾的普及。
在未来,人工智能和数据挖掘将继续引领技术的发展潮流,推动社会进步和经济增长。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。



